Erick Schonfeld says that the rumor is that Google will unveil the long-ago rumored Google Calendar at Tuesday’s When 2.0 conference at Stanford. I’ll be eagerly awaiting it, but I’m not sure how many people will actually use it. How many people use group calendars?

More importantly, will Google Calendar use some company’s calendar format (not Googly), a brand-new incompatible format (Googly), offer converters from but not to other formats (very Googly, a year or two into the beta), or will Google do the smart and diplomatic thing? Will Google Calendar steal some of Microsoft’s thunder and support RSS SSE?

If it doesn’t, it will when everyone else starts supporting it. SSE is too useful to lose, even if it was Microsoft’s idea.
